directions

  • Preheat oven to 350F Line an 8-in square baking pan with aluminum foil, leaving an overhang on all sides.
  • In a food processor, pulse pecans until finely chopped. Transfer to a bowl and set aside. In processor blend four, sugar, butter and salt until moist clumps form. Add reserved pecans; pulse 2 or 3 times, just to blend.
  • Press dough evenly into the bottom of prepared pan. If dough is sticky, dip fingers into flour. With a floured fork, prick dough every 1/2 inch. Bake until golden, 30 to 35 minutes.
  • Cool 5 minutes in pan. Use foil overhang to lift shortbread from pan onto cutting board. With a serrated knife, carefully cut warm shortbread into 18 bars (6 rows by 3 rows). Remove from foil; cool bars completely on a rack before serving.
